    Default 2017 FW questions

    My 16 FW was totaled in hurricane Ian. Geico treated me well. Looking at a 17 with 14000 miles. All the add ons I like. Perfect condition. Any comments on the first year M8? New front suspension? I haven't seen it in person yet. Are the 17's cable or hydraulic clutch? Sumping or transfer issues? Thanks guys

    Hydraulic clutch if that matters but make sure they did all recalls and updates for the transfer issues…..(primary vent)..

    The clutch actuator had a recall - at least my '18 built in 9/17 did. The vent kit isnt all that expensive and comes with a template. If you like the trike and the price is good then go for it.

    I have the 17 FW since last January and it has been a terrific Trike. Yes it does have the hydraulic clutch which I do really like. I have not had a single issue (with it) since I got it. If you don't have the Harley Davidson USA app on your phone, you might want to add it. It's a very cool app that also asks you to put in your Vin# and tracks any recalls or issues for your trike. Lots of other cool stuff to play with on there as well. Good luck with whatever you decide.
